1. MediaTek not only sells chips but also provides supporting software services, the so-called turn-key model. This is currently unrivaled in the industry, which is why some manufacturers with limited capabilities like to adopt it. MediaTek's mobile phone solution has low development costs and fast mass production. Currently, Qualcomm is also taking this path. The QRD content is similar to the Turn-Key mode.
